I am a clergy widow and a clergy mother. Like many other older people, apart from a small savings account, my house is my only asset and my income comes from a tiny private pension and the state.

My daughter and I had long cherished a hope to be able to go on pilgrimage together to the Holy Land, but financially it was beyond our reach. Unexpectedly, my daughter, then a curate, was offered an almost free ticket by her diocese on their annual pilgrimage. She was excited but reluctant to go without me.

I could see no way of affording the cost without help, so my daughter suggested contacting Clergy Support Trust. I have an inbuilt reluctance to ask for such help, but knowing my daughter would probably not go without me, late in the day I bit the bullet and applied for assistance.

Miraculously it was granted, and appeared in my bank account the day before the deadline for travel payment. What a blessing and privilege it was to be able to walk in the footsteps of our Lord and Saviour.

Thank you Clergy Support Trust for enabling both of us to enrich our spiritual lives.
